"Traditionally black and white have been used in Yin-Yang symbols to represent opposites of energies: positive and negative, masculine and feminine, receptivity and aggression. However, we are never truly 100% on either end of those spectrums. No one is 100% masculine, nor 100% feminine for example. With Zen-like form we flow between the two energies. In this unique pendant design, artist Jaqui Michells has re-defined the ancient. Sculpting the form from light and shadow, we can see here that Yin and Yang have no delineation between them. Thus, in a literal sense, we see the flow of the energies - how they meet and combine. The pendant also rotates. As it does, Yin becomes Yang, and Yang becomes Yin, emphasizing the changing nature of all energy." © J.
